How Our Window Leak Water Removal Process Works
When you call us for window leak water removal, our team springs into action. We’ll arrive on the scene within 60 minutes equipped with the latest technology to assess the damage and develop a plan to restore your property. Our process is thorough, efficient, and designed to reduce stress and disruption to your daily life.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our technicians will conduct a thorough assessment of the damage, identifying the source of the leak and the extent of the water damage. We’ll then develop a customized plan to remove the water, dry the affected area, and restore your property to its original condition. This step typically takes 1-2 hours to complete.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
Using specialized equipment, including industrial-grade pumps and air movers our team will carefully remove the standing water and extract as much moisture as possible from the affected area. This step typically takes 2-4 hours to complete.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Next, our team will use industrial-grade d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air and speed up the drying process. We’ll also use desiccants to absorb any remaining moisture. This step typically takes 2-5 days to complete.
Step 4: Restoration and Repair
Once the affected area is dry, our team will begin the restoration and repair process. This may involve replacing damaged drywall installing new flooring or repairing damaged ceilings. Warning Signs You Need Window Leak Water Removal
Ignoring the signs of a window leak can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Don’t wait until it’s too late, look out for these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your home or building can show the presence of mold and mildew. If the smell persists even after cleaning, it’s time to call in the professionals. We’ll identify the source of the odor and take steps to remove it.
Warped or Discolored Wood
Warped or discolored wood can be a sign of water damage. If you notice your windowsills, floors, or walls are no longer straight or have visible stains, it’s time to act. Our team will assess the damage and develop a plan to restore your property.

Window Leak Water Removal Cost in Ennis, TX
Estimating the cost of window leak water removal can be challenging, as it dep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Ennis, TX. But, we can provide you with some general estimates based on our experience: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ions |
| Water Removal and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, labor costs |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, labor costs |
| Restoration and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, labor costs |
| Professional Inspection and Assessment | $200 – $1,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ions |
